Francis Francois Carew is a classically trained guitarist with nearly four decades of guitar experience. Francois has a Bachelor of Music in Classical Guitar Performance (2011) and a Master of Arts in Musicology (2018) from Wayne State University. He is a professional guitarist, music instructor, and musicologist that performs, teaches, and lectures throughout Michigan. Francois specializes in fingerstyle acoustic guitar but also plays and teaches electric guitar and bass guitar. He brings the classical perspective to Rock, Heavy Metal, Jazz-Blues, Flamenco, and Latin American music styles.

Francois is a guitarist of extraordinary musical depth and talent and has an excellent technical command of electric and acoustic guitar, which allows him to bring out their sensitive, melodious, and harmonic nature. Francois has been on the faculty of the Interlochen Arts Academy Guitar Festival and Workshops (2009, 2010, 2011) and Marshall’s School of Music (2006-2018). He teaches Classical, Flamenco, Jazz-Blues, Rock and Roll, and Heavy Metal guitar styles.
